A Study Concerning the Relationships among an Early Childhood Educator’s Type of MBTI Personal Tendencies, Creativity, and Teaching Efficacy

ABSTRACT
This study examined the relationship among early childhood educator’s MBTI personal tendencies, creativity, and teaching efficacy. 120 kindergarten teachers and 155 day care teachers participated in this study. Several survey questionnaires were used for this study, such as, teaching efficacy scale, MBTI personality tendencies, and a creativity test. The collected data was analyzed with the SPSS program(version 18.0). The findings of this study were as follows: First, there were some differences between an early childhood educator’s MBTI personal tendencies and creativity. Secondly, there was a positive correlation among early childhood educator’s MBTI personal tendencies, creativity, and teaching efficacy.
